While often overlooked, the glass on a solar panel is fundamental to its performance and longevity. Solar panel glass is not the same as standard window glass; it is a highly engineered product that must withstand extreme weather, thermal stress, and impact for over 25 years. The Engineering of Solar Glass

Solar panel glass must meet stringent requirements. It must have low iron content to maximize transparency and allow sunlight to reach the cells. It must be thermally tempered, a process that strengthens the glass to withstand hail, high winds, and snow loads. Its edges must be sealed to protect the fragile cells and electrical connections from moisture and corrosion.

The trend towards ultra-thin (2.0mm) glass is growing, particularly for bifacial modules, as it reduces weight and material costs while maintaining strength. This innovation is a direct response to the industry's need to lower costs and increase efficiency. The glass's ability to perform these roles reliably over decades makes it the unsung hero of the solar panel.

The Dominance of Crystalline Silicon Modules

Crystalline Silicon Modules dominate the solar panel glass market. Their proven efficiency and reliability make them the standard technology in the industry. The demand for glass to cover these billions of panels creates the largest and most stable segment of the market. This dominance is expected to continue, driven by ongoing improvements in module efficiency and cost.

The close relationship between panel manufacturers and glass producers is crucial. Companies like Trina Solar, LONGi, and Canadian Solar are major buyers of solar glass, and their production volumes shape the entire supply chain for this essential component. The scale of this segment supports massive glass manufacturing capacity, especially in Asia.

The Growing Market for Tempered Glass

Tempered Glass is a key product type, holding a significant market share. Its increased mechanical strength is non-negotiable for ensuring module durability and safety. Without tempering, the glass would be too fragile to handle the mechanical loads and thermal stresses of outdoor operation.

In contrast, the Anti-reflective (AR) Coated glass segment remains the largest, driven by the need for maximum light transmission. AR coatings have become an industry standard for high-performance panels. The Transparent Conductive Oxide (TCO) segment is the fastest-growing, essential for advanced thin-film technologies.

Regional Supply Chain Dynamics

The Asia-Pacific region, led by China, is the center of solar glass manufacturing, accounting for the vast majority of global production. North America is the fastest-growing region for consumption, driven by new policies that encourage domestic manufacturing and deployment. Europe remains a significant market for premium products like AR-coated and BIPV glass. These regional dynamics create a complex and interconnected global supply chain.

Future Outlook: Lightweight and Self-Cleaning Glass

The future of solar panel glass is focused on innovation to reduce weight and improve performance. The development of lightweight, ultra-thin glass for bifacial modules will continue. We will also see the widespread adoption of self-cleaning glass coatings that use the sun's energy to break down dirt, reducing maintenance costs. As the industry pushes for even longer lifespans and lower costs, the evolution of solar panel glass will be a key factor in the success of Solar PV Glass Market.
